Well the titan doesn't usually get to 120 fps on ultra 1440p however you said high, unfortunately no one tests/reviews using high so I can't answer that, as for the second part of recording at 60fps, yes it would (if it comes into existence) be able to do that since recording with shadow play for instance does not remotely impact performance.
